DESMARETS DE SAINT-SORLIN (Jean). [Clovis, ou la France chrestienne, poème héroïque. A Paris, chez A. Courbé et H. Le Gras, 1657]. In-4, [16] (of 17) f., 464 p., [1] blank f., fr., pl., antique speckled parchment, 5-nerved spine, fawn title page, red edges (upper guard missing, without letterpressed title page, small damage to corner of 1st front, 2nd doubled, some minor browning and soiling, worm spots in margins at beginning of vol. then p.237 to 263, lacks plate of Canto 24; most plate ornaments slightly cut by binder).
First edition of this work, renowned for the quality of its copper-engraved hors-texte illustration, comprising a frontispiece by N. Pitau after Charles Le Brun, an unsigned equestrian portrait of Louis XIV jeune engraved by Jean Couvay after Bourdon, a copper-engraved crowned figure plate, and 26 unsigned plates, 22 of which engraved by François Chauveau and 4 by Abraham Bosse. Each plate is composed of a central vignette and figures above and below, forming a compositional style that was completely innovative for its time, giving this work a remarkable place in the history of 17th-century illustrated books.
(Brunet II, 633).
